Can anyone introduce me a tutorial on  "yield" and  "interrupt" of Thread?

Hello, everyone!
I am learning JAVA Thread. I have read all the parts of section "Threads: Doing Two or More Tasks at Once (Essential Java Classes) " of the tutorial "The JAVA Toturial" on java.sun.com but failed to find anything about the usage of functions "yield" and "interrupt".
Can anyone introduce me some tutorials or simple source codes dealing with the usage of the two functions?
Thanks in advance,
George

yield is used when you want to let another thread run. Its particularly useless as the scheduler will handle this anyway. Its especially useless in a JVM where the behavior of the scheduler is unpredictable. In a language such as c/c++ where it only runs in one place generally, you can understand the scheduler and help it a bit with yield, but in Java you really do not know for sure where your code will run, and any improvements yield will bring probably can be directed toward inefficiencies in the Thread scheduler of the jvm.
interrupt is basically a request. It only works on certain methods that are checking for it. So you can't have your thread doing just anything and think you can "interrupt" it. For instance, if you are blocking on a socket operation, interrupt will probably not do anything.

Similar Messages

  • Can anyone recommend a good tutorial on how to use pre-designed website templates in Dreamweaver? Thks

    I am fairly new to Dreamweaver (cs6), having previously designed and maintained a few sites using Freeway. I purchased a template from TemplateMonster.com in the hope that this would simplify the creation of a new site. The template came without any instructions other than how to unzip the file. Their helpline really isn't helpful at all. Can anyone recommend an online tutorial on how to use a predesigned template? Lynda.com doesn't have one. Thanks!

    I found this page :
    http://www.templatemonster.com/dreamweaver-templates.php
    Followed a link. Ended up here :
    http://www.webdesign.org/tutorials/html-and-css/page-1.html
    Did a search. Found this :
    http://www.webdesign.org/search.html?keywords=dreamweaver&category=6
    Then this :
    http://www.webdesign.org/web-design-basics/templates-tuning/working-with-templat e-using-html-editor.1546.html

  • Plugged in Apple TV, Apple symbol appears the a view of the rear of the box with a USB lead going to an iTunes symbol? Can anyone shed some light on this oh and it doesn't go past this point

    Plugged in Apple TV, Apple symbol appears the a view of the rear of the box with a USB lead going to an iTunes symbol? Can anyone shed some light on this oh and it doesn't go past this point

    You need to grab a micro usb cable and restore via iTunes
    http://support.apple.com/kb/HT4367?viewlocale=en_US&locale=en_US

  • Can anyone help with issue whereby Music, Podcasts and Audiable Book Apps keep stopping when listing via Headphones following IOS 7.01 Updates on Iphone 4?

    Can anyone help with issue whereby Music, Podcasts and Audiable Book Apps keep stopping when listing via Headphones following IOS 7.06 Updates on Iphone 4?
    I have tried the following all ready:
    Resetting Phone
    Resetting Settings on phone
    Change Headsets to speakers
    Reinstalled Phone
    Updated to IOS 7.1
    No of the above has resolved the issue does anyone have any ideas?

    Can anyone help with issue whereby Music, Podcasts and Audiable Book Apps keep stopping when listing via Headphones following IOS 7.06 Updates on Iphone 4?
    I have tried the following all ready:
    Resetting Phone
    Resetting Settings on phone
    Change Headsets to speakers
    Reinstalled Phone
    Updated to IOS 7.1
    No of the above has resolved the issue does anyone have any ideas?

  • I can't find preferences for the notes app. and every once in awhile some of my notes just disappear at start up, I see the name and then it refreshes and they are gone, very annoying. Can anyone tell me why it does this and how to stop it? thanks

    I can't find preferences for the notes app. and every once in awhile some of my notes just disappear at start up, I see the name and then it refreshes and they are gone, very annoying. Can anyone tell me why it does this and how to stop it? thanks

    Hi again, I am on an iMac using OSX 10.7.5, I"ve taken screenshots to show you I think my settings are correct

  • When i go to my music and play a song it sounds like my headphones are blown but when i play songs on youtube they sound fine, can anyone explain this to me? please and thank you

    when i go to my music and play a song it sounds like my headphones are blown but when i play songs on youtube they sound fine, can anyone explain this to me? please and thank you

    Try:
    - Reset the iOS device. Nothing will be lost
    Reset iOS device: Hold down the On/Off button and the Home button at the same time for at
    least ten seconds, until the Apple logo appears.
    - Unsync all music and resync
    - Reset all settings      
    Go to Settings > General > Reset and tap Reset All Settings.
    All your preferences and settings are reset. Information (such as contacts and calendars) and media (such as songs and videos) aren’t affected.
    - Restore from backup. See:                                 
    iOS: How to back up                                                                
    - Restore to factory settings/new iOS device.      

  • Hi I am using iphone 4, since last few days i am facing problem in touch screen at times it doesn't work at all for 5-10 mins and then it works out itself. Can anyone pls suggest what the problem is and how it can be sorted out?

    Hi I am using iphone 4, since last few days i am facing problem in touch screen at times it doesn’t work at all for 5-10 mins and then it works out itself. Can anyone pls suggest what the problem is and how it can be sorted out?

    Did you recently updated to 7.0.4? Even for me same also issues.

  • When I switch libraries I lose the majority of the material in my main library and can only restore it by repairing the database. Can anyone tell me why this is happening and how I can resolve the problem? Thanks

    When I switch libraries I "lose" the majority of the material in my main library (or at least I can't see it) and can only restore it by repairing the database. Can anyone tell me why this is happening and how I can resolve the problem? Thanks

    I seem to have found a way around it. Rather than switching libraries by going into files/switch libraries I used Aperture Preferences to change them. I've done it a couple of times and it appears to work OK.
    That is an interesting finding. It suggests, that your "Preferences" file "com.apple.Aperture.plist" may have been corrupted and you fixed it this way. Can you now switch between libraries the usual way? If not, I'd try to remove the "preferences" file from the user library to the Desktop and relaunch Aperture.
    The Aperture 3: Troubleshooting Basics:http://support.apple.com/kb/HT3805
    describe how to remove the user preferences.

  • Can anyone help me I downloaded drake ablum and it said it comes with digital booklet but I don't see it and I downloaded the iBook and still don't see it I need help

    Can anyone help me I downloaded drake ablum and it said it comes with digital booklet but I don't see it and I downloaded the iBook and still don't see it I need help

    Your iTunes Digital Booklet should appear on the PDF shelf in iBooks.

  • Can anyone tell me what this messsage means and how to fix it?

    I use CS3 to prepare a black and white newsletter for our village onmy MAC and frequently change colour photos to greyscale.  However when printing on my HP Colour Laserjet 2550L the photo shows as a dark green colour.  I've tried everything imaginable, new drivers etc. but still get the green print instead of greyscale. 
    The ColorSync Utility had just appeared on my desktop with the following message:
    Searching for profiles...
    Checking 54 profiles...
    /Library/ColorSync/Profiles/EW-sRGB
       Tag 'desc': Tag size is not correct. Could not be fixed.
    /Library/Application Support/Adobe/Color/Profiles/Recommended/CoatedFOGRA27.icc
       Tag 'desc': Tag size is not correct.
       The file is locked. Could not be fixed.
    Repair done - 0 out of 2 profiles fixed.
    Could this be the problem?  And if so, how do I fix it?
    Don't really want to uninstall and reinstall but expect that's the only answer.  Is it?  Can anyone help?

    The driver is one the Apple Mac store downloaded for me.
    I attach the print summary which might give a clue.  When converting 
    files to grayscale, I use Image>Mode>grayscale.  The other thing is 
    that I can't print in Photoshop, so I do all my editing in Photoshop 
    and print through Indesign.  Printing in Photoshop is just a page of 
    text.
    The other odd thing is that coloured pdf files printed in Adobe 
    Acrobat are just a mass of colour, no recognisable picture but if I 
    change the print option in Acrobat to print in grayscale I get 
    pictures!  I just feel I'm overlooking some checked option, but I've 
    tried to restore to default without success.  I used to use Pagemaker 
    6.0 to do my newsletter on my PC but had to change to Indesign when I 
    changed to MAC and the printer hasn't worked properly since!!!
    Many thanks for your reply.  Maybe someone out there might be able to 
    help.

  • Can anyone make a PKGBUILD for Novel iFolder and Novel consoleone ?

    Like in subject. I tried install it from Novel homepage, but i have problem with make dependiences and this two package, can anyone make good PKGBUILD for new version ? In AUR i found PKGBUILD's but the mirror doesn't work and i can't find another mirror. Thanks Igor. Have a nice day !

    Yes, but i saw many rpm package, and source code. If you talk about license there is oportunity to get free license for 30 or 60 day's. Thanx for respone.

  • Please can anyone test this for me? V200 and Repeat Folder play m

    Hi
    Does anyone here use the play mode called Repeat Folder?
    I have selected this play mode and it works fine, but how do you
    then change/skip to another folder?
    If I try then the unit gets confused and goes from
    my folder called DireStraits of 2 to DireStraits 2of2
    instead of to U2 2 of 2. Sometimes I can get it to skip
    to another folder by scrolling in the other direction but
    basically it does not allow me to skip to another folder.
    So, what I have to do is change to Normal mode say,
    then skip to another folder (which works just fine) and
    then turn the play mode back Repeat Folder.
    I think this is a buglet?
    Can anyone else confirm this behaviour or confirm that they
    get normal behaviour once the play mode is set to Repeat Folder.
    Thanks in advanceMessage Edited by will77 on 02-02-2005 0:47 AMMessage Edited by will77 on 02-07-2005 06:44 PM

    elmulti wrote:
    Hi will77,Can you describe what happens if you are in "repeat-folder" mode and select "skip folder" and then scroll to the left or right?
    Thanks a lot. Yes. if I scroll right then it goes to the next folder (sometimes) or
    jumps a folder or misses one or goes nowhere sometimes, and if I select the folder
    it does go to, then it show the track name, but I cannot play it, hitting play
    pause play does nothing. If I scroll to the left then I sometimes can get to the folders
    it does not show when I scroll right, but again, if I select the folder presented to me
    the track will not play. Also I think sometimes it gets confused and does not know whether
    to scroll along folder by folder or scroll along track by track within a folder.
    Any ideas?
    Any MuVo V200 users out there then?
    Thanks in advance.

  • I have a state space model of a complex system. can anyone help me for implementi​ng MPC and e-MPC control for the same?????

    Hi everyone. I am new to the forums, so let me be as mprecise as possible. i know the basic functionalities of Labview with MPC block etc. However, i dont know how to go ahead with implementing MPC control for a system whose state space model i possess. can anyone help me out?? the problem is that i dont even know the approach or the starting point..

    This happens if you remove a program manually, but still have the registry keys to load files from this program.<br />
    You can use the MSConfig program or the Autoruns utility to see which software and services are getting started.
    *http://technet.microsoft.com/en-us/sysinternals/bb963902.aspx
    You can use registry editor and do a search (Ctrl+D) for imesh to see if you can locate the registry key(s) that launches this program on a reboot.
    Try to ask advice at a Windows oriented forum if you can't fix this.
    * http://www.bleepingcomputer.com/forums/ - BleepingComputer.com - Computer Help Forums
    * http://windowssecrets.com/forums/ Windows Secrets Lounge

  • I am completely new to Logic pro x. Can anyone help me on what to do and how to start making basic beats?

    I just purchased a mac and bought Logic Pro X. I have used fruity loops a little bit but this is completely different. Can anyone help me on getting started to make basic beats or anything?

    Just a suggestion. You can pick up Apple Pro Training Series Logic Pro 9 & Logic Express 9 (iBooks or Amazon). It will be a good start as the versions are somewhat similar. It may be a while till something more current and specific will be out for learning Logic Pro X from the ground up.
    There are few Youtube sources are available as well.

  • Can anyone tell me how eject a disc and also the desktop shows no icon

    Can anyone tell me how to eject a disc from an imac.  Also the desktop doesn't show a disc icon.   Help!

    The very top row on your keyboard, right over the delete button, there is a button with a pyramid on it.  Push that button.
    Good luck!

Maybe you are looking for

  • Report needed: Customer master TAXKD field changes

    We are looking to track changes made to TAXKD (tax code) in customer master.   Is there any report we could generate weekly that would detail changes made to the field.  Also, we'd like what change was made.  (i.e. customer number, date, field change

  • Capital projects and Grants Accounting

    We looking at the feasibility of creating capital projects in Grants Accounting as part of our R12 project. I need to know whether it is possible to combine non-sponsored capital project types with our existing sponsored projects funded by awards. I

  • How to get music from Apple TV to play through all 5.1 channels

    I recently set up a new 5.1 channel receiver and 5 very nice speakers. However, when I go to play music from Apple TV the sound only comes through to the front left and right speakers. Is there a way to play music through all 5 speakers? Is the recei

  • Conflicting items

    I just downloaded a twitter app for my nokia asha 201 from store and i kepp getting conflicting item everytime i tried opening it..... Pls i need an urgent help on fixing it...waited long for the app already

  • Error creating a file

    I am trying to extract text from a PDF and save it as plain text. I have written the script below, which almost works perfectly! When creating the text file (via javascript) it fails if I set the name to the variable newName, however if I just use th